STATE Adelaide, January--February 2006 WEATHER: Warm Free Doctor Who off air by staff writers Doctor absent, fans anxious. DOCTOR WHO fans are facing the prospect of life without televised episodes. For the first time in almost two and a half years the well has run dry with the ABC repeats ending on February 3rd and no further Doctor Who scheduled. THE CHRISTMAS INVASION HIT! by staff writers The Christmas Invasion special continues Doctor Who’s ratings wins. Chameleon Factor # 80 The sixty minute special premiered on BBC One on Christmas Day, 2005. Rating 9.84 million viewers, it was beaten by Eastenders, but in turn beat O ut t N No Coronation Street to be the second highest rated show of the day. ow ! The Christmas Invasion was repeated on BBC Three on January 1st with- out the annoying station logo. This repeat was seen by 501,700 viewers, which is regarded as a high figure. THE CHRISTMAS INVASION HIT! q from Page 1 The end of the classic repeats signal the end of Doctor Who broadcasts on free-to-air television for the foreseeable future. The schedule for the second series was not even written at the time of publication, and delivery of the new episodes was expected to be “a few months” away. ABC has the rights to one repeat of the 2005 episodes. They do not plan to show any more classic Who, including the skipped Dalek episodes, K-9 and Company or the 1996 telemovie with Paul McGann (known to fans as The Enemy Within). Hong Kong’s ATV World has picked up Doctor Who for a February 19 pre- miere (your editor’s birthday). This joins the US Sci-Fi Channel, French Canadian channel Ztelé, Spain’s Digital Plus and Showtime Arabia for new Meteor Crater, Arizona, the sales. New episodes have screened in France, Italy, New Zealand, Norway, most famous meteorite stike location. South Korea and Belgium. It has also been purchased by Denmark, Finland, Hungary, The Netherlands, Germany and Israel. The absent postcolonial transition in Doctor Who Lindy A Orthia The Australian National University, Canberra, Australia Abstract This paper explores discourses of colonialism, cosmopolitanism and postcolonialism in the long-running television series, Doctor Who. Doctor Who has frequently explored past colonial scenarios and has depicted cosmopolitan futures as multiracial and queer- positive, constructing a teleological model of human history. Yet postcolonial transition stages between the overthrow of colonialism and the instatement of cosmopolitan polities have received little attention within the program. This apparent ‘yawning chasm’ — this inability to acknowledge the material realities of an inequitable postcolonial world shaped by exploitative trade practices, diasporic trauma and racist discrimination — is whitewashed by the representation of past, present and future humanity as unchangingly diverse; literally fixed in happy demographic variety. Harmonious cosmopolitanism is thus presented as a non-negotiable fact of human inevitability, casting instances of racist oppression as unnatural blips. Under this construction, the postcolonial transition needs no explication, because to throw off colonialism’s chains is merely to revert to a more natural state of humanness, that is, cosmopolitanism. Only a few Doctor Who stories break with this model to deal with the ‘sociopathetic abscess’ that is real life postcolonial modernity. Key Words Doctor Who, cosmopolitanism, colonialism, postcolonialism, race, teleology, science fiction This is the submitted version of a paper that has been published with minor changes in The Journal of Commonwealth Literature, 45(2): 207-225. 1 1. Final publication available at Springer via http://dx.doi.org/10.1007/s11199-016-0597-y CULTURE OF SCIENTIFIC COMPETENCE 2 Abstract The present study examines the relationship between gender and scientific competence in fictional representations of scientists in the British science fiction television program Doctor Who. Previous studies of fictional scientists have argued that women are often depicted as less scientifically capable than men, but these have largely taken a simple demographic approach or focused exclusively on female scientist characters. By examining both male and female scientists (n = 222) depicted over the first 50 years of Doctor Who, our study shows that, although male scientists significantly outnumbered female scientists in all but the most recent decade, both genders have consistently been depicted as equally competent in scientific matters. However, an in-depth analysis of several characters depicted as extremely scientifically non-credible found that their behavior, appearance, and relations were universally marked by more subtle violations of gender expectations.

    FREE WITHNAIL & I: EVERYTHING YOU EVER WANTED TO KNOW BUT WERE TOO DRUNK TO ASK PDF Thomas Hewitt-McManus | 124 pages | 20 Apr 2012 | Lulu.com | 9781411658219 | English | Morrisville, United States Withnail and I - Wikipedia Withnail and I is a British black comedy film written and directed by Bruce Robinson. Based on Robinson's life in London in the late s, the plot follows two unemployed young actors, Withnail and "I" portrayed by Richard E. Grant and Paul McGann who live in a squalid flat in Camden Town in while squandering their finances on alcohol. Needing a holiday, they obtain the key to a country cottage in the Lake District belonging to Withnail's lecherous gay uncle Monty and drive there. The weekend holiday proves less recuperative than they expected. Withnail and I was Grant's first film and launched him into a successful career. The film has tragic and comic elements particularly farce and is notable for its period music and many quotable lines. It has been described as "one of Britain's biggest cult films". The film depicts the lives and misadventures of two unemployed young actors in late London. They are the flamboyant alcoholic Withnail and "I" named "Marwood" in the published screenplay but not in the credits as his relatively more level- headed friend and the film's narrator. Withnail comes from a privileged background and sets the tone for the friendship. They live in a filthy Georgian flat in Camden Town. Their only company at the flat is the local drug dealer, Danny. The roommates squabble about housekeeping and leave to take a walk.
